Welcome to ASQU, Advanced Seminars for QuickBooks Users (pronounced “ask”). This seminar is designed to help you achieve your next level in understanding QuickBooks. The seminar is not a beginner’s seminar, but is designed for the person who has been using QuickBooks and is familiar with the basics of the program.

This year the seminar will be two days – Wednesday and Thursday, August 5th and 6th. We will be back at the Green Center at the School of Mines in Golden.

View the website under “Instructors” to see who will be presenting this year. Presenters are Advanced Certified QuickBooks ProAdvisors, members of the Intuit Accounting Professionals Trainer and Writer Network, and/or members of the Sleeter Consultants Network. These speakers have made QuickBooks presentations at local classes, national conferences and training events. And each has expertise in working with many different clients. Each instructor will be available at some time in the lobby for one-on-one discussions. If you have questions not covered in the presentations, you will be able to have these experts work with you to get your answers. Come; join us as they share their QuickBooks knowledge with you.

Look at the “Seminar Topics” page to see the topics for this year’s presentations.
This is a unique seminar in that there will be 3 or 4 presentations during each time frame. You will be able to select the seminar topics you wish to attend to enhance your understanding of QuickBooks. Read through the information on this website and watch for registration to open the first part of June when you can sign up. There will be a number of new topics as well as a few repeats from last year. The sessions will by 75 minutes (1½ academic hours) in length so that if you need CPE each session will be 1½ CPE hours.
